Understanding the Importance of Snow and Ice Removal
Heat pumps are designed to operate year-round, transferring heat to maintain comfortable indoor temperatures. However, heavy snowfalls and freezing rain can interfere with the system’s ability to function effectively. Ice and snow accumulation around or on the unit can block airflow, strain the motor, and compromise energy efficiency. In extreme cases, this buildup may even damage the heat pump’s components, leading to costly repairs or replacements.
Assess the Situation Before Taking Action
Before diving into the snow removal process, inspect the extent of the accumulation. A light layer of frost might resolve itself through the heat pump’s defrost cycle. However, substantial ice or thick snow should be addressed immediately. Make sure to turn off the system and disconnect the power supply before attempting any removal procedures to avoid safety risks and potential damage.
Use Gentle Tools and Techniques
When clearing snow and ice from your heat pump, it’s vital to avoid using sharp or heavy tools that could harm the unit. Instead, opt for non-abrasive methods:
- Manually Remove Snow
Use a broom or soft brush to gently sweep away loose snow from the top and sides of the heat pump. Avoid pressing hard against the unit to prevent bending the delicate fins or damaging internal components. - Warm Water Application
For ice buildup, pour warm—not boiling—water over the affected areas to melt the ice gradually. Ensure the water flows away from the system to prevent it from refreezing around the unit. - Defrost Setting
Activate the defrost mode on your heat pump, if available, to eliminate frost and thin layers of ice. This built-in feature cycles the system to melt ice by temporarily reversing its operation.
Preventing Future Ice and Snow Buildup
Proactive measures can help minimize the recurrence of snow and ice accumulation on your heat pump:
- Install a Cover or Shelter
Position a protective cover or shelter above the unit to shield it from direct snowfall while maintaining adequate airflow. Be cautious not to block ventilation, as this can negatively impact the system’s performance. - Maintain Clearance Around the Unit
Regularly clear debris, snowdrifts, and overhanging branches around the heat pump. Ensure at least two feet of open space on all sides to facilitate proper airflow. - Routine Maintenance Checks
Schedule periodic inspections and maintenance by a professional to ensure your heat pump remains in peak condition. These checks can identify and address issues before they escalate during harsh weather conditions.
What to Avoid During Snow and Ice Removal
Using improper methods can cause more harm than good when dealing with a heat pump. Avoid these common mistakes:
- Using Sharp Tools
Shovels, ice picks, or other pointed objects can puncture or dent the heat pump, leading to irreparable damage. Stick to soft tools designed for delicate surfaces. - Applying Excessive Heat
Do not use blowtorches, heat guns, or similar devices to melt ice. These tools can warp components, damage electrical systems, or create fire hazards. - Forcing Ice Removal
Avoid prying or chipping away at the ice. Forcing ice off can dislodge or break vital parts of the heat pump.
Recognizing When to Seek Professional Help
If snow and ice continue to build up despite your efforts, or if the heat pump exhibits unusual noises or reduced efficiency, it’s time to consult a professional. A trained technician can safely remove the ice, inspect for potential damage, and ensure the unit is functioning correctly. Regular maintenance by professionals can also extend the lifespan of your heat pump and prevent seasonal complications.
